In the History
 During the second half of the 19th
  century, nationalist consciousness
  spread across India and self-help
  emerged as the primary focus of
  sociopolitical movements.
 Numerous organizations were
  established during this period, including
  the Friend-in-Need Society
  (1858), Prathana Samaj (1864), Satya
  Shodhan Samaj (1873), Arya Samaj
  (1875), the National Council for
  Women in India (1875), and the Indian
  National Conference (1887).

NGOs / Voluntary Service
Though the term NGO became popular in
 India only in the 1980s, the voluntary
 sector has an older tradition.
Since independence from the British in
 1947, the voluntary sector had a lot of
 respect in the minds of people -
 first, because the father of the nation
 Mahatma Gandhi was an active
 participant; and second because India
 has always had the tradition of honouring
 those who have made some sacrifice to
 help others.
Voluntary Organizations -
Gandhiji
In independent India, the initial role played by
  the voluntary organizations started by Gandhi
  and his disciples was to fill in the gaps left by
  the government in the development process.
  The volunteers organized handloom
  weavers in villages to form cooperatives
  through which they could market their
  products directly in the cities, and thus get a
  better price. Similar cooperatives were later
  set up in areas like marketing of dairy
  products and fish. In almost all these
  cases, the volunteers helped in other areas of
  development - running literacy classes for
  adults at night, for example.
Traditional
Traditional development NGOs, who
 went into a village or a group of
 villages and ran literacy
 programmes, crËches for children and
 clinics, encouraged farmers to
 experiment with new crops and
 livestock breeds that would bring
 more money, helped the weavers and
 other village artisans market their
 products and so on
Research / Advocacy / Legal
The second group of NGOs were those
 who researched a particular subject in
 depth, and then lobbied with the
 government or with industry or
 petitioned the courts for improvements
 in the lives of the citizens, as far as
 that particular subject was concerned.
 Eg: CSE
Activists
In the third group were those
  volunteers who saw themselves
  more as activists than other
  NGOs did. They petitioned the
  bureaucrats, they alerted the
  media whenever they found
  something wrong and so on. Eg:
  NBA

Advantages of NGOs
 Less pressure from change in politics
 Small scale projects
    ◦ More community involvement
    ◦ Can be individually tailored to meet
      specific community needs
    ◦ Higher “success” rate
    ◦ Less bureaucratic
   A more “human” face
Disadvantages of NGOs
   Constant funding difficulties
   Possible lack of legitimacy
   Difficult to regulate
    ◦ Can lack transparency and accountability
    Can be ineffective due to lack of
    coordination

NGOs in India
The PRIA survey reveals that
26.5% of NGOs are engaged in
  religious activities
21.3% work in the area of community
  and/or social service.
About one in five NGOs works in
  education
7.9% are active in the fields of sports
  and culture.
6.6% work in the health sector.
